The Gap Between Who You Are and How You Appear
We all carry an inner self-image — strong, warm, intelligent, grounded.
But cameras can flatten that into something unfamiliar.
This happens when:
• The lighting is unflattering
• The pose feels unnatural
• The face holds tension
• The photographer offers little direction
What shows up in the photo is not the real you.
It’s the version of you trying hard to “look right.”
This is why so many professionals say:
“My photos don’t look like me.”
Not because they’re not photogenic.
But because no one helped them express who they truly are.
Presence Can Be Guided
In my Basel photo studio, every portrait begins with stillness.
We breathe.
We soften.
The nervous system settles.
From there, I guide every detail:
• How to hold your posture without stiffness
• How to define and lengthen the jawline
• How to soften the eyes while remaining strong
• How to express presence rather than performance
This isn’t posing.
It’s revealing.
When the body feels supported, the face relaxes into authenticity.
